Hi, Normally, a .ICS file automatically opens in the Calendar app and it will automatically populate it's info into your calendar. Sometimes, though, Exchange servers put info in the file which errors in Calendar, but the data still remains in Calendar unless you tell it to "Revert to Server". You can use TextEdit to open the .ICS file and look through it although you'll note most of it is gobbly-goop to the reader. There is info you can deem from it though which may help you find where it got put in your Calendar. You can then simply do a search when in your Calendar, find the entry and/or edit/action anything that you wish to.
